WebSep 4, 2024 · The total angular momentum about the hinge is $0$ by symmetry, but that does not mean the rods are not rotating about the hinge. It just means the rods are rotating at the same speed in opposite directions. You can figure the rotation rate by considering the angular momentum of one rod+block about the hinge. WebMay 17, 2024 · Imagine what would happen if the rod was not hinged, it would rotate about a the COM of rod (and not about mid point of forces (see Farcher's answer). The Hinge reaction develops to counter this rotation resulting in a net force on the COM of the rod. The hinge reaction is the reason why the COM of the rod moves.
